Stijn D'Hondt

Stijn D’Hondt is a Belgian visual artist with a Bachelor of Fine Arts from Sint-Lucas Ghent. His practice spans advertising, creative direction, and the creation of visual artworks, often informed by his travels around the world. Through these journeys, he seeks to build emotional connections across borders, using shared human experiences as his primary language.

He is the co-founder of Heren Loebas, a creative studio he established with Peter Van de Sijpe, dedicated to crafting thoughtful, high-quality narratives that amplify the power of stories. Stijn’s artistic work explores themes of life and death through the use of color, offering spaces of dignity, reflection, and honor for human processes. He is deeply interested in developing socially engaged projects that foster love and celebrate its diversity in a world often divided by prejudice and cultural taboos.

His work has earned several distinctions, including the Henry van de Velde Awards (Gold Award), Belgian Corporate Video Festival, and De Standaard Solidariteitsprijs (2018), among others. He currently lives between Belgium and Mexico City, where he is represented by Banana Contemporary and is developing Artbeats, a project that explores the poetic language behind the heartbeat.
